SPENCER; Robert J. Fecteau, 66, of 101 Ash St., died Saturday, March 21, at St. Vincent Hospital in Worcester.
He leaves his wife of 43 years, Carolyn J. (Marcello) Fecteau, two daughters; Christina J. Pickett of Worcester, Renee J. Fecteau of Ft. Lauderdale, FL., two sons, Raymond J. Fecteau of San Francisco, CA., Robert J. Fecteau, II of Medford, two sisters; Pauline Casavant and her husband Wallace of Spencer, Vivian Bartlett and her husband Robert of Worcester, 3 grandchildren; Erin Power, Raymond and Ryan Pickett and several nieces and nephews.
Born in Worcester, he was the son of Raymond and Ida (Audette) Fecteau.
Mr. Fecteau was an International Sales Manager for 25 years at Reed Rico in Holden, retiring in 2004. He was a graduate of Holy Name High School in Worcester and of Worcester State College. He served his country in the Air Force during the Vietnam War. He was a member of Mary, Queen of the Rosary Parish in Spencer and served on the Parish Council and its Finance Committee and was a lecture and altar server. He was an avid sportsman and a member of the MA Wildlife Association, MA Audubon Society and previously served on the Spencer Conservation Commission. He was a member of the Laurelwood Riding Club in Spencer and the Minuteman Model "A" Club of MA.
